Blackpool: Bulk Road closed
Motorists in the area surrounding Lancaster are advised to plan their journeys carefully as a section of Bulk Road will be closed due to urgent roadworks, starting from 17:00 on 16 August 2026 and lasting until 01:00 on 17 August 2026.

The nearest major city is Blackpool. This closure has been implemented by Lancashire County Council.
The closure is expected to cause medium disruption, and drivers are encouraged to use alternative routes to avoid the area.
